Output 38b60f3640e17d734a44f01d1caf2f32f5c01ef8e713f2a432a8795fb69e15a0:0

value
153745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3dc94c231819471db0879c5104c6e87e396a2c OP_EQUAL
address
3EkQZxsczirGcQsVyw5BbCbxJMxXx86RuJ
transaction
38b60f3640e17d734a44f01d1caf2f32f5c01ef8e713f2a432a8795fb69e15a0